Job Description
We are seeking a highly motivated individual, who can work well under pressure to meet demanding deadlines with little or no supervision. In this role, the successful candidate will be responsible for the 14 CFR Part 145 Certified Repair Station (CRS): management and delivery of hands-on Quality Control Inspections as well as Internal and Outside Supplier Quality Assurance Audits and Mobile Repair Unit maintenance activity Field Evaluations. In this role, he/she will be responsible for collaboration with the CRS Management Team. The Manager of Quality will also manage all Non-destructive Testing functions (NDT), and aid in the development of CRS Training Program through needs assessments and course development as well as delivery of CRS course Instruction.
Additionally, this individual will provide Quality Engineering support coordination of the overall Aerospace Quality Management System, repair development and STC program management.
To be considered for the role, candidates must be deemed eligible for consideration for advancement to the Chief Inspector role.
Reports to: Chief Inspector; FAA CRS
Responsibilities (including, but not limited to; a proven track record of performing all of the tasks below):
Performing and instructing others regarding hands-on Quality Control (QC) Inspection of aircraft, aircraft engine and propeller maintenance and modifications as an individual contributor and/or manager
Performing and instructing others regarding hands-on QC conformity inspection regarding avionics installations as an individual contributor and/or manager
Manage Non-Destructive Testing functions.
Developing, conducting and instruction of others regarding effective supplier surveillance and vendor rating management of OEMs, Repair/Overhaul Vendors, raw materials, and Aeronautical Part Distributors
Developing and managing an Internal Evaluation Program in an FAA CRS environment
Quality Control management in an advanced quality management system e.g., ISO 9001, AS 9100 and/or AS 9110
External Audit (as Auditee) coordination in an FAA CRS environment
Effective root cause analysis, corrective action, and preventative action development
Strong aeronautical regulatory and quality standard compliance negotiation
